sprüche und wünsche
Computers and Technology

Everything You Should Know About BI Testing

Organizations are now aiming to incorporate best practices of DevOps and software development techniques into their analytics efforts.
This explains the reason why
BI testing is an obvious choice. It is significantly more efficient to catch an issue before it enters production, both for internal users and external consumers than to deal with the implications later. Any company that employs analytics platforms should do frequent BI testing to uncover problems before they are seen by users, ensuring credibility and avoiding risk.

Why Do You Need BI Testing?

Before we get started with BI testing, it’s important to understand why business integration testing is necessary. When analytics impact the work of apps, business integration is by far the most important procedure.

For example, suppose you relocate and need to use your credit card to make a payment. But due to the shift in location, the BI application flags it as a strange transaction. To prevent fraud, such modifications may be made using BI.

Additionally, numerous additional scenarios in business integration might severely impact the behavior of your application. As a result, business intelligence testing enters the picture. By attaining BI analytics and reports, it assists you in locating and resolving system flaws after making adjustments to the application procedure.

BI Testing Process

Let us now take a look at the business intelligence testing method:- 

1. Verify the Data at the Source

A data source is among the most important aspects of business intelligence since it is the initial location where data is saved and supplied to all important operations. A single comma or full stop error may wreak havoc on a piece of work.

Furthermore, for a business intelligence operation, there may be several sources of data, all of which are saturated with data in various forms. As a result, data validation at the source is vital, as is data type matching on both the sender and receiver ends.

You may do this by incorporating a series of data validation requirements to verify that data types are matched on both ends and that erroneous fields are not filled in. To avoid discarding data, you must confirm that data arriving from sources is valid at this stage.

You can also correct data without forwarding it for further analysis. It’s commonly referred to as the “Extract” step of ETL.

2. Double-check Your Data Transformation

You must first understand data transformation before moving on to the underlying notion. It is, in fact, a step in the business transformation process when raw data is processed and business-targeted information is obtained.

You can assure data symmetry across the process by matching both the source as well as destination data types.

Keep an eye on the primary key, foreign key, default value constraint, null value constraints, and other aspects of the database. As per the database, everything should be correct and complete.

3. Check for Data Loading

Within corporate business intelligence procedures, slow data loading may be a severe problem. And the test and the data loading scripts would be key components for your ETL testing. You have to verify the following in conjunction with the data storage system.

Performance Testing: As systems get more complex, relationships between things begin to establish co-relations. But apart from providing respite, it also adds to the complexity of data, lengthening the time it takes to get data via queries. As a result, performance testing is required to verify that data is accessed quickly and efficiently.

Scalability Testing: Data will continue to increase over time. As a result, scalability testing becomes a requirement to assure continuous data processing during installation as the company grows in size.

Furthermore, testing areas like failure recovery, computing capability, and exception handling, are more beneficial than others. BI testing solutions may assist you in improving the scalability of your software for smooth operation.

4. BI Report Validation

Reporting is the final stage of the business intelligence process, and testing is the final attribute. BI reports, like any other report, are prone to errors. It’s also unrealistic to assume them to be constant and quick.

In such circumstances, it is vital to test the following features:- 

  • Examine the reports that have been prepared to see if they apply to the business.
  • Check that you can modify and alter report settings including classification, grouping, sorting, etc.
  • Examine the report’s readability.
  • In the end-to-end testing, the application’s functionality corresponds to the BI parts.


BI testing can benefit your software business if it is implemented properly. And to get the best results, you must consider taking the help of a professional software testing company like QASource.

Visit QASource now to implement premium BI testing services for your software business.

Related Articles

Leave a Reply

Your email address will not be published. Required fields are marked *

Back to top button
escort Georgia bayan escort Ankara
canlı casino siteleri casino siteleri 1xbet giriş casino sex hikayeleri oku